Vibration eliminating device of escalator driving chain and escalator

By installing a vibration elimination device consisting of a lever arm, contact block, vibration absorber, etc. on the escalator drive chain, the natural vibration mode of the drive chain is changed, resonance and vibration are eliminated, the drive chain vibration problem is solved, the transmission efficiency is improved and wear is reduced.

Abstract

The invention discloses a vibration eliminating device of an escalator driving chain. The vibration eliminating device comprises a lever arm, a contact block, a vibration absorbing piece, a partition plate assembly, a stop baffle, a shell and a fixing piece. The contact block is rotatably fixed at the first end of the lever arm, and the partition plate assembly is fixed at the second end of the lever arm; the partition plate assembly is rotatably fixed in the shell and divides the interior of the shell into at least two spaces; the stop baffle is fixed to the shell and provided with a protruding part protruding towards the interior of the shell. The vibration absorption piece is arranged between the partition plate assembly in the shell and the protruding part of the stop baffle. The shell is fixed on a truss structure of the escalator through a fixing piece, and the contact block is placed on at least one row of driving chains under the action of gravity. According to the invention, the chain does not need to be tensioned or any existing design parameter does not need to be changed, the transverse resonance of the driving chain can be reduced or eliminated, and the run-out of the driving chain in operation is reduced.

Technical Field

[0001] The present invention relates to the technical field of passenger conveying devices, and in particular to a vibration eliminating device for an escalator drive chain. Background Art

[0002] When an escalator is in operation and a certain number of passengers are on board, the drive chain will experience severe lateral vibration. This vibration will cause a large dynamic load during the high-speed transmission of the drive chain, increasing chain wear and vibration, and even causing tooth skipping, reducing transmission efficiency.

[0003] Chinese patent document CN119079759A discloses a method for reducing or eliminating drive chain vibration by tensioning the drive chain using one or two toothed telescopic mechanisms; raising or moving the main drive unit forward or backward; and adjusting the escalator's operating speed through a controller. However, this technical solution is complex in structure and control, and reduces escalator operating efficiency. Summary of the Invention

[0004] In order to solve the above technical problems, the present invention provides a vibration elimination device for an escalator drive chain, comprising a lever arm, a contact block, a vibration absorbing member, a partition assembly, a stop baffle, a housing and a fixing member;

[0005] The contact block is rotatably fixed to the first end of the lever arm, and the partition assembly is fixed to the second end of the lever arm; the partition assembly is rotatably fixed in the shell to divide the shell into at least two spaces; the stop baffle is fixed on the shell and has a protrusion protruding into the shell; the vibration absorber is arranged between the partition assembly and the protrusion of the stop baffle in the shell; the shell is fixed to the truss structure of the escalator through a fixing member, and the contact block is placed on at least one row of drive chains under the action of gravity.

[0006] Preferably, the partition assembly divides the shell into four identical spaces.

[0007] Preferably, the partition assembly is made of the same material as the lever arm, preferably steel, and is welded and fixed to the lever arm. Preferably, the vibration absorbing member is rubber.

[0008] Preferably, the vibration absorbing rubber is selected by direct testing.

[0009] Preferably, the stiffness and hardness of the vibration absorbing member are selected according to the maximum force at the midpoint of the drive chain, so that the rotation angle of the partition assembly after being subjected to force is smaller than a preset value.

[0010] Preferably, the contact block is made of nylon or other wear-resistant materials.

[0011] Preferably, the contact block is placed at a free edge of the drive chain.

[0012] Preferably, the vibration absorbing member has a groove, and the protrusion of the stop baffle in the shell is inserted into the groove.

[0013] The present invention also provides an escalator comprising the aforementioned vibration eliminating device.

[0014] Compared with the prior art, the present invention does not require chain tensioning or changing any existing design parameters. It only reduces or eliminates the lateral resonance of the drive chain and reduces the vibration of the drive chain during operation by adding a vibration elimination device. [0023] Example 1

[0024] like Figures 1 to 4 As shown, this embodiment provides a vibration elimination device for an escalator drive chain, comprising a lever arm 1, a contact block 2, a vibration absorbing member 4, a partition assembly 5, a stop baffle 6, a housing 7 and a fixing member 8;

[0025] The contact block 2 is rotatably fixed to the first end of the lever arm 1, and the partition assembly 5 is fixed to the second end of the lever arm 1; the partition assembly 5 is rotatably fixed in the shell 7, dividing the shell 7 into at least two spaces; in this embodiment, the partition assembly 5 divides the shell 7 into four identical spaces; the partition assembly 5 and the lever arm 1 are made of the same material, and the partition assembly 5 is welded to the lever arm 1.

[0026] The stop baffle 6 is fixed to the housing 7 and has a protrusion protruding into the housing 7. The vibration absorbing member 4 is made of rubber and is arranged between the partition assembly 5 in the housing 7 and the protrusion of the stop baffle 6.

[0027] Alternatively, the vibration absorbing member 4 has a groove, and the protrusion of the stopping baffle 6 in the housing 7 is inserted into the groove.

[0028] like Figure 3 and Figure 4 As shown, housing 7 is fixed to the escalator's truss structure (e.g., a truss brace) via fixings 8. Contact block 2 is placed under gravity on at least one row of drive chains 21. Contact block 2 is made of nylon and is placed at the free edge of drive chain 21.

[0029] When the contact block 2 is subjected to chain vibration and transmitted to the lever arm 1, the partition assembly 5 rotates to drive the vibration absorbing member 4 to rotate, and then is squeezed by the stop baffle 6 fixed on the housing, thereby achieving the function of vibration absorption and energy consumption.

[0030] The position of the contact block 2 on the free edge of the drive chain 21 can be changed. The lever arm 1 can be directed towards the step sprocket 22 or the drive sprocket 23; or two contact blocks 2 can be used, one on each of the rollers of the two rows of drive chain 21.

[0031] The natural frequency of the lateral vibration of the drive chain is as follows:

[0033] Where f i is the i-th natural frequency of the drive chain, i is the frequency order, L is the free side length of the drive chain, T is the chain tension, and m0 is the mass per unit length of chain. Reducing the free side length L increases the resonance frequency f.

[0034] In this embodiment, the contact block of the vibration elimination device contacts the drive chain, thereby reducing the free edge length, changing the first-order natural vibration mode of the drive chain, and increasing the resonance frequency, thereby reducing or completely eliminating the drive chain resonance caused by passenger load.

[0035] In addition to completely eliminating the first-order resonance mode of the drive chain under specific loads, this embodiment can also reduce or eliminate the jitter in the drive chain. Even slight jitter can be eliminated by rotating the lever arm 1 to drive the diaphragm assembly 5, thereby compressing the vibration absorber 4.

[0036] The selection of vibration absorbing rubber can be done by direct test method, which is to conduct compression test on rubber specimens of specific shape, size, hardness and formula, such as Figure 5 As shown in the figure, the force F and the compression angle δ are directly measured and the F-δ curve is plotted. Furthermore, the relationship between the rotation angle of the diaphragm assembly and the force at the nylon wedge can be obtained.

[0037] During design, the stiffness and hardness of the vibration absorber can be selected according to the maximum force at the midpoint of the drive chain, so that the rotation angle of the partition assembly after the force is applied is less than the preset value, in order to prevent the chain from vibrating. Figure 6 As shown, taking a bus-type escalator as an example, the drive chain tension when the chain resonates is: 17803N. The chord length of the middle part of the chain when it vibrates is about 20-30mm, and the free side length is 1100mm. It can be simply calculated that the force at the midpoint of the chain is 652N-963N.
